Based on a post here, I checked my Westjet flights for August to MCO from YYZ. Well...they changed both my outbound and inbound direct flights, I now have a layover, and it has implications for when I can COVID test in Orlando. The kicker? They didn't tell me my flights are changed. So PLEASE check your flights. And their customer service line is not accepting calls at this time and you can't make adjustments online.
